Produktionsumgebung


Produktionsumgebung
Wenn Sie eine Anwendung für die Verwendung in einer Produktionsumgebung verpacken müssen, können Sie den Produktionsmodus von Parcel verwenden.

parcel build entry.js

Dadurch werden der Überwachungsmodus und das Modul-Hot-Swapping deaktiviert, sodass nur einmal erstellt wird. Es aktiviert auch den Minifier, der zum Komprimieren der Dateigröße des Ausgabepakets verwendet wird. Zu den von Parcel verwendeten Minifiern gehören uglify-es für JavaScript, cssnano für CSS und htmlnano für HTML.
Um den Produktionsmodus zu aktivieren, muss auch die Umgebungsvariable NODE_ENV = Produktion festgelegt werden. Große Bibliotheken wie React verfügen über Entwicklungs-Debugging-Funktionen, indem Sie diese Umgebungsvariable festlegen, wodurch Produktions-Builds kleiner und schneller werden.
Optionen
Legen Sie das Ausgabeverzeichnis fest
Standard: "dist"

parcel build entry.js --out-dir build/output
或者
parcel build entry.js -d build/output
rrree

Legen Sie die öffentliche URL fest serviert
Standard: --out-dir Option

root
- build
- - output
- - - entry.js

gibt Folgendes aus:

parcel build entry.js --public-url ./

Komprimierung deaktivieren
Standard: Minimierung aktiviert

<link rel="stylesheet" type="text/css" href="1a2b3c4d.css">
or
<script src="e5f6g7h8.js"></script>

Dateisystem-Cache deaktivieren
Standard: Cache aktiviert

parcel build entry.js --no-minify